A new law to ban certain foods from meal deals and controls on high fat, sugar, or salt content to tackle obesity, has been announced by the Welsh government.
Certain foods in meal deals will be restricted in Wales as well as volume-based promotions, such as multi-buys, the Labour-run Welsh government announced on Tuesday.
The ban will also put restrictions on where products high in fat, sugar, or salt can be displayed, such as at the end of aisles.
The law will be introduced in 2024 and will be rolled out across Wales by 2025.
It said that it will build “on the commitment to improve diets and help prevent obesity by restricting the ways foods high in fat, sugar, or salt can be promoted.”…
